Kansas GOP congressman pleased with treatment of migrants

 


TOPEKA, Kan. (AP) — A Kansas Republican congressman said after a recent trip to Texas that he is pleased with the quality of medical attention and housing for migrants held in federal facilities at the southern border.

The Kansas City Star reports Rep. Roger Marshall toured several sites in the McAllen area, including a processing center, a tent city and a warehouse where migrants are held. He said the trip to the border re-solidified his support for President Donald Trump's border wall proposal.
